Answers:
1. SUBORN - Bribe or otherwise induce someone to do something illegal - especially to influence a witness to commit perjury
2. ENTROPY - Lack of order or predictability
3. MAUDLIN - Overly sentimental
4. NOMINAL - Very small, as a fee
5. ABROGATE - Avoid responsibility or duty
6. SYMBIOTIC - Mutually beneficial, as the clownfish enjoys the protection of the stinging sea anemone, while with its bright colors the clownfish lures prey into the anemone's tentacles.
7. ENCOMIUM - A speech or piece of writing praising someone or something, as a eulogy
8. HYPPERBOLE - Exaggeration to such an extent that it's not intended to be taken seriously, as, "I've seen that movie a hundred times."
9. INTERPOLATE - In math, to estimate a future point based on available data, project. Also, to insert new material into a book or text - thus changing it in some way
10. PERFUNCTORY - Done with little effort or reflection, cursory
